Output 90e992922afa0f445109a6f1385b104729d880973fb06c8155f74742633b0a03:51

value
28220675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f28e1928c65c933cb9396cbe12cc7ba9e2a1fb4 OP_EQUAL
address
3EjyXStDJ2DQQZTVWfh8pwJ13VywKcBDJi
transaction
90e992922afa0f445109a6f1385b104729d880973fb06c8155f74742633b0a03
spent
true